VA Manhattan Library Service The Learning Resources Center ( library service ) at the VA NY Harbor Healthcare System is committed to enhancing patient care through the advancement of clinical education and research. The VANYHHS sponsors and manages several dental residency programs (general practice and specialties) and post graduate training. The library service would like to procure access to EBSCO s Dental Oral Science Source Databases or its equivalent, covering all facets of dentistry including dental public health, endodontics, facial pain & surgery, odontology, oral and maxillofacial pathology/surgery/radiology, orthodontology, periodontology and prosthodontics, which would help support the dental training programs sponsored by the VANYHHS. Providing database access will help improve interactions between patients and their dental providers. Dental and oral science databases assist with diagnosis and treatment, managing documentation and billing, and helping to reduce errors in dental operations and management. Objective The VA New York Harbor Healthcare System (VANYHHS) Learning Resources Center requires unlimited 24-hour online database access (both on-site and remote) for dental and oral science practitioners and trainees at Manhattan, Brooklyn and Queens Campuses. The online dental and oral science database shall encompass all the following: Requirements: A database which aggregates dental and oral science journals and covers all facets of dentistry including dental public health, endodontics, facial pain & surgery, odontology, oral and maxillofacial pathology/surgery/radiology, orthodontology, periodontology and prosthodontics. Access to full-text dental and oral science articles Access to recently published literature to the present with as little embargos as possible with minimal waiting time for access to the latest dental and oral science journals Access to dentistry magazines, trade publications, and scholarly peer-reviewed journals Access to approximately 377 non-open access, high impact, authoritative and the most heavily used journals for dental and oral science practitioners and researchers Access to open-access journals The Contractor shall: Provide the VANYHHS Manhattan, Brooklyn and Queens staff with online database access (both on-site and remote) Provide training to library staff and its patrons in the use of the database Regularly provide content updates and add new content to the database Software upgrades included at no additional charge Provide a technician to configure customization options as requested for the database Provide promotional materials for the database Configure the database to provide usage statistics Provide telephone, Zoom or Microsoft Teams screensharing and/or on-site technical support within a 24-hour timeframe to troubleshoot and resolve access issues Place of Performance The products and services are to be delivered and completed at: The VA NY Harbor Healthcare System is comprised of three campuses: Hospital: VA New York Harbor Healthcare System Manhattan Campus Room 2225N 423 East 23rd St. New York, NY 10010 Hospital: VA New York Harbor Healthcare System Brooklyn Campus Room 2-101A 800 Poly Place Brooklyn, NY 11209 Long-Term Care Facility: VA New York Harbor Healthcare System Queens Campus 179-00 Linden Boulevard Queens, NY 11424-1468 Estimated Period of Performance 7/1/2022 - 06/30/2023 with a provisional four (4) option years. ----------------------------------------- (END) -------------------------------------------- The following information is required for determining procurement strategy and viability of sources: Set aside requirements have limitations on subcontracting. As prescribed in 819.7009(c) insert the following clause: VA NOTICE OF LIMITATIONS ON SUBCONTRACTING CERTIFICATE OF COMPLIANCE FOR SERVICES AND CONSTRUCTION (SEP 2021) (DEVIATION) (a) Pursuant to 38 U.S.C. 8127(k)(2), the offeror certifies that (1) If awarded a contract (see FAR 2.101 definition), it will comply with the limitations on subcontracting requirement as provided in the solicitation and the resultant contract, as follows: [Contracting Officer check the appropriate box below based on the predominant NAICS code assigned to the instant acquisition as set forth in FAR 19.102.] (i) [ ] Services. In the case of a contract for services (except construction), the contractor will not pay more than 50% of the amount paid by the government to it to firms that are not VIP-listed SDVOSBs as set forth in 852.219-10 or VOSBs as set forth in 852.219-11. Any work that a similarly situated VIP-listed subcontractor further subcontracts will count towards the 50% subcontract amount that cannot be exceeded. Other direct costs may be excluded to the extent they are not the principal purpose of the acquisition and small business concerns do not provide the service as set forth in 13 CFR 125.6. (ii) [ ] General construction. In the case of a contract for general construction, the contractor will not pay more than 85% of the amount paid by the government to it to firms that are not VIP-listed SDVOSBs as set forth in 852.219-10 or VOSBs as set forth in 852.219-11. Any work that a similarly situated VIP-listed subcontractor further subcontracts will count towards the 85% subcontract amount that cannot be exceeded. Cost of materials are excluded and not considered to be subcontracted. (iii) Special trade construction contractors. In the case of a contract for special trade contractors, the contractor will not pay more than 75% of the amount paid by the government to it to firms that are not VIP-listed SDVOSBs as set forth in 852.219-10 or VOSBs as set forth in 852.219-11. Any work that a similarly situated subcontractor further subcontracts will count towards the 75% subcontract amount that cannot be exceeded. Cost of materials are excluded and not considered to be subcontracted.
